Calculated Grades 2020

All 6th year established Leaving Certificate students and 5th and 6th Leaving Certificate Applied students successfully opted in to receive calculated grades this year as the Leaving Certificate examinations were cancelled, due to the impact of Covid-19. Calculated Grades Results

The Calculated Grades will issue to students on 7 September. All students will reveive their results through the Calculated Grades Student Portal.

St. Dominic's College will evaluate closer to the time if it is possible to welcome the students receiving results to the school on results day, as would normally be the case. Because all of the school community will have resumed classes by this date, the priority has to be maintaining the safety and security of the school environment and minimising risk of Covid-19 transmission.

What will definitely not change is how the school will support all of our 6th year students as they progress from post-primary education to higher and further education and the world of work. As always, your wellbeing will be our priority and we will have a system in place for providing guidance, advice and support to you. We are more conscious than ever that this has been a year like no other for all 6th Year students.

The results date is slightly later than it would be if students had sat the examinations, this is the earliest that the results can be made available, given the rigorous and robust process that is involved in the Calculated Grades process.

The process includes a national standardisation process, validation of the statistical model and many quality assurance checks to ensure that the grades are accurate, reliable and fair to all students.
